  10. A 2003 xr6 turbo was recently advertised on ebay for a buy it now price of $7200. Thinking it was a scam I emailed just to see. He replied about it below, which sounds even more bizarre. Currently there is a black xr6 turbo being sold by a member from Germany with a buy it now of 8000… It MUST be a scam, not that Id ever fall for it, people should be wary. Has anybody heard about new ebay car scams? “ Hello there and thanks for your interest. The car is in excellent condition .No scratches or any kind of damage. It has a clear title. If you are interested in buying it the price is $7,200 Aud. The car will be shipped from United Kingdom , on my expense and will be delivered directly to your door in 9-10 days.I will pay the shipping fees.The car will be insured at the shipping company for the transport. All documents, including owner's manual, clear title and a bill of sale on your name will be provided along with the car. The car is still Australia registered so you will not have to pay any custom taxes. The transaction will be made under eBay's buyer protection plan for our own safety. Your funds will be 100% insured by eBay and I will be sure that I will receive the payment. You will have 15 days from the time you receive the car to inspect it and decide if you want to keep it or not. If you are interested in buying it please provide me your full name and address so I can initiate the deal through eBay. I'm a serious seller and a fair trader and I prefer to deal only with a serious buyer. I look forward to hearing from you. Thanks ”
